Star Wars: Battlefront 2
Genre: Online shooter
Platform: PS4/Xbox One/PC
Age: 16+
Return to a galaxy far, far away for massive multiplayer battles on foot, in vehicles and in space. And this time there’s an awesome-looking single-player campaign too. Lightsabers at the ready!
Pokémon Ultra Sun/Ultra Moon
Genre: RPG/adventure
Platform: Nintendo 2DS/3DS
Age: 7+
Another chance to catch ‘em all with Pokémon Ultra Sun and Ultra Moon. Grab your Pokédex and head out into beautiful Alola, where you can find new Pokémon to train, new forms to unlock and even more battle moves to try out against your friends!

Stranger Things: The Game
Genre: RPG puzzler
Platform: Mobile (iOS/Android)
Age: 12+
If you’ve seen season one of this amazing ‘80s-themed Netflix adventure show, you’ll love the tie-in game. Available to play on mobile, you’ll control your team, solve puzzles, fight monsters and ultimately, save the town!
Cute, amazing, and better still, completely free to play (no in-app purchases necessary), get ready to go retro. We think you’ll love it!
